We're partnering with a market-leading, highly regulated organisation to recruit a newly created Lead Data Engineer position. This is a fantastic opportunity for a hands-on data engineering leader to take ownership of a growing data function, leading a team while remaining actively involved in technical delivery.

Acting as the bridge between senior leadership and the data team, you'll be responsible for the data engineering roadmap, platform development, engineering standards, and delivery capability. This is a genuine player-coach role, with a roughly 60/40 split between hands-on engineering and leadership responsibilities.

The Role

  • Lead and develop a team of Data Engineers and Data Analysts
  • Own the data engineering function, platform roadmap, and delivery priorities
  • Design, build, and optimise data pipelines, integrations, and warehouse solutions
  • Drive best practice across SQL, Python, data modelling, and engineering standards
  • Improve platform reliability, performance, and scalability
  • Lead data quality, monitoring, and observability initiatives
  • Work closely with senior stakeholders across the business to deliver data-driven outcomes
  • Evaluate new tools, technologies, and future platform requirements

Brush Up on Your Statistics

For a data science role, we need to seriously sharpen our statistics skills. Get ready to tackle technical questions on probability distributions, hypothesis testing, and regression analysis. These are often the bread and butter of data science interviews, so don't just skim over them!

Showcase Your Projects

Prepare a killer portfolio showcasing your data science projects. We should include details about the datasets used, the tools and techniques applied, and the impact of your findings. If we can walk them through a particularly challenging project or a cool visualisation that had real-world implications, it’ll really make us stand out!

Get Comfortable with Python and R

Most data science positions require us to be proficient in programming languages like Python and R. We should practice common libraries like pandas, NumPy, and scikit-learn, and be ready for live coding exercises or algorithm questions. Showing off our coding chops can really impress the interviewers at Eutopia Solutions!

Prepare for Case Studies

Expect to encounter real-world case studies during the interview. We might be asked how we’d approach a data problem or analyse a dataset to extract insights. It's essential to think out loud and demonstrate our problem-solving process so that the interviewer can see our logical thinking in action.
